Choosing the Correct Digital Device for Test, Measurement, and Control

One of the most important steps in project development is determining which device provides the best solution for your application. Current test and measurement systems usually require some form of digital input and output, whether for toggling a few digital control lines to change a device's state or for generating advanced patterns to validate a custom circuit. National Instruments offers a wide range of digital products to help meet the digital needs of your applications.

The four main digital products available from National Instruments include:

  • Industrial digital I/O
  • Reconfigurable I/O
  • M Series multifunction DAQ
  • Digital waveform generator/analyzers (high-speed digital I/O)

Digital I/O Specification Comparisons

The following table provides a quick specifications comparison of the different National Instruments digital devices. For more information on a specific device, refer to the product pages.

Model Name Max Data Rate (Mb/s) Max Pins Per Board Voltage Levels Max Current Multidevice Delay Max Onboard Memory Isolation Platform
High-Speed Digital I/O
NI 656x 400 Mb/s 16 LVDS LVDS- compliant T-Clock (10’s of ps) 128 Mb/ch - PXI
NI 655x 100 Mb/s 20 Programmable -2.0 to 5.5 V 50 mA T-Clock (10’s of ps) 64 Mb/ch - PXI, PCI
NI 654x 100 Mb/s 32 Software-selectable 5.0, 3.3, 2.5, 1.8 V 32 mA T-Clock (10’s of ps) 64 Mb/ch - PXI, PCI
NI 6534 20 Mb/s 32 5 V TTL/CMOS 24 mA RTSI (±1 sample) 32 Mb/ch1 - PXI, PCI, PCMCIA, ISA
NI 6533 20 Mb/s 32 5 V TTL/CMOS 24 mA RTSI (±1 sample) - - PXI, PCI, PCMCIA, ISA
Industrial Digital I/O
NI 652x Software-timed 24 input, 24 output ±60 VDC 150 mA RTSI (±1 sample) - Channel-channel PXI, PCI
NI 651x Software-timed 32 or 64 ±30 VDC 500 mA - - Bank PXI, PCI
NI 650x Software-timed 24 or 96 5 V TTL/CMOS 24 mA - - - PXI, PCI, PCMCIA, USB
Multifunction DAQ (M Series and S Series)
NI 625x or NI 628x 10 Mb/s 32 5 V TTL/CMOS 24 mA RTSI (±1 sample) - - PXI, PCI
NI 622x 1 Mb/s 32 5 V TTL/CMOS 24 mA RTSI (±1 sample) - - PXI, PCI
NI 61xx 10 Mb/s 8 5 V TTL/CMOS 24 mA RTSI (±1 sample) - - PXI, PCI
Reconfigurable I/O (R Series and CompactRIO)
cRIO-9411 2 Mb/s 6 (input) Differential or 5 V TTL - - - Channel-earth CompactRIO
cRIO-947x 1 Mb/s 8 (output) 5 to 30 V 1 A - - Channel-earth CompactRIO
cRIO-942x "0.1 to 1 Mb/s" 8 or 32 (input) 24 V - - - Channel-earth CompactRIO

1 The 32 Mbit/channel applies to 8 bit groups
